GHG Emissions Data
Oriental Fastech Manufacturing Vietnam
We have used the data for the year 2016 as our baseline for Scope 2 emissions.
GHG Emissions Data for Year of 2022 to 2024 compared to the 2016 baseline
Tonnes of CO2e
2024 2023 2022 Base year 2016
Scope 2 113 139 259 279
Total Gross Emissions 113 139 259 279

We do not have scope 1 emissions as there are no direct emissions generated in our operations.
Scope 3 emissions are not included in our measurement and reporting at this point in time.
In 2022, we reduced our CO2e intensity (per unit of revenue) by 11.0% compared to the base year 2016.
In 2023, we reduced our CO2e intensity (per unit of revenue) by 51.5% compared to the base year 2016.
In 2024, we reduced our CO2e intensity (per unit of revenue) by 57.0% compared to the base year 2016.
Carbon Reduction Target

We will continue to maintain our target of a 52% reduction in GHG emissions intensity (Scope 2) per million USD sales revenue by 2025.

Carbon Reduction Initiative & Action Plan

Optimize energy efficiency by studying consumption patterns and upgrading equipment.
Install energy-efficient inverters to reduce electricity use.
Enhance staff engagement on Zero Carbon initiatives through internal communication.
While renewable energy adoption faces challenges, we continue exploring feasible solutions.
Allocate part of our profits to purchase Renewable Energy Certificates (RECs) to support our carbon reduction goals.

Electricity and Paper Consumption

The Group promotes environmentally conscious work practices such as energy saving and recycling in order to reduce adverse impact on the environment. It monitors the energy and water consumption on a monthly basis and any unusual deviations are promptly addressed and investigated. Employees are educated to switch off air-conditioning and lights during lunch hours and after office hours to reduce unnecessary energy consumption. Also, any water leakage is fixed as soon as it is noticed to avoid waste. Employees are also encouraged to reduce printing or photocopying, and where possible, to use double side printing and recycled paper to reduce carbon footprint on the environment. The Group also encourages a paperless working environment and practise online E-payment to suppliers, E-notification from human resource department to all employees and E-Annual Report to shareholders.

Waste Management

The Group ensures that waste is properly managed and stored. Used materials such as papers or paper cartons are reused, where possible, or collected by scrap collector to recycling centre. Non-recyclable waste is disposed of responsibly in compliance with regulatory requirements through appointed waste contractor.
